Love those pics in the snow! Do they use salt on the roads or do you just use winter tyres and get on with it?
-
Salt on the main roads, but a lot of smaller roads (Wich there is ALOT of in Norway) is the snow just removed, leaving often a slippery ice/snow surface. But we are not allowed to use summer tires in the wintertime.
